PHPBB2 is a free forum. It runs on PHP and supports many database systems.

PHPBB* is the new version of PHPBB, but I'm not sure when it will be released. It might be worth waiting for it to come out.

Other than that, vBulletin costs *****. Unless you want to pirate vBulletin, I advise PHPBB2/*.